Todoist

Todoist is a renowned productivity app that integrates artificial intelligence to enhance task management. Its unique features facilitate efficient organization and prioritization of tasks, helping users streamline their daily responsibilities.

One standout feature is the Smart Schedule function, which uses AI to suggest optimal due dates for tasks. This capability considers the user’s past behavior and workload, ensuring deadlines are both realistic and efficient. Additionally, Todoist offers task categorization through labels and filters, allowing individuals or teams to effectively manage complex projects.

Collaboration is also a key focus, as Todoist allows users to share projects and assign tasks within teams. The app’s user-friendly interface combined with its AI capabilities promotes seamless communication, making it easier to achieve shared goals. The incorporation of natural language processing enhances input efficiency, allowing users to create tasks quickly by simply typing in conversational phrases.

Trello

Trello is a versatile task management tool that leverages AI to enhance productivity and streamline workflows. Its card and board system allows users to visualize tasks and projects effectively, facilitating better organization and prioritization. The integration of AI algorithms helps users predict task durations and suggest optimal project timelines.

One of Trello’s key features is the ability to automate repetitive tasks through its Butler automation tool. This AI-driven feature can handle reminders, move cards, and update due dates based on user-defined triggers, significantly reducing manual effort. Additionally, Trello’s power-ups enable integration with various AI applications, further enhancing its functionality.

AI Algorithms and Their Application in Task Prioritization

AI algorithms significantly enhance task prioritization in productivity apps by leveraging data analysis and machine learning techniques. These algorithms assess various attributes of tasks, such as deadlines, complexity, and dependencies, to determine the optimal order for completion.

For instance, machine learning models can analyze past user behavior and task performance to adjust priorities dynamically. By doing so, these algorithms ensure that critical tasks receive attention without neglecting less urgent but essential activities, ultimately enhancing overall workflow.

Another application of AI in task prioritization involves natural language processing (NLP). NLP algorithms can interpret task descriptions and categorize them based on urgency and relevance. This capability streamlines the prioritization process, enabling users to focus on high-impact activities.
